Harmony In Kalachakra
From Monday, 06 February 2012
To Monday, 13 February 2012
Hits : 501

An 8-day Residential Course. Led by Andy Wistreich.

This course is being run with the intention to support those who attended the Kalachakra Intiation given by His Holiness the Dalai Lama in Bodhgaya, India between December 30, 2011 – January 10, 2012. However, this course is suitable for all students who have attended one of our 10-day introductory courses or equivalent.

This course will enable students to explore two important personal and global issues within the framework of the Kalachakra (Wheel of Time) Buddhist system. Both concern the harmonisation of areas of life where disharmony is often experienced – the environment and personal relationships. The first topic of the course will teach methods for harmonising the inner and outer elements – helping us to heal the body and our relationship with nature. The second topic will teach methods for harmonising the male and female aspects of one's psyche as a basis for making more harmonious relationships with others. Therefore, in a very practical and relevant way, the course will also provide an introduction to the Kalachakra system of inner and outer transformation. The methods taught will not be the actual practices of the Kalachakra tantra, in order to enable those who haven't taken the initiation to attend and benefit. However, for those initiates planning to or already practising the Kalachakra yogas, this course will provide an excellent enrichment to your practice.

Recommended Reading:

  • "Taking the Kalachakra Initiation" - Alexander Berzin
  • "The Practice of Kalachakra" - Glenn Mullin
  • "The Inner Kalacakratantra" - Vesna Wallace
